The Caldecott Tunnel involved the construction of a fourth bore through the Berkeley Hills near Oakland, California. We partnered with local and state transportation officials to provide environmental documents and design services for this landmark project.

We help keep drinking water flowing for residents of Southern Nevada, supporting the Southern Nevada Water Authority with project management/construction management (PM/CM) services. This includes tunneling under Lake Mead—a project which set a world record for the highest-pressure excavation completed.

Project Highlight: Dubai Strategic Sewerage Tunnels – Dubai, United Arab Emirates (UAE)

The Dubai Municipality is working on the Dubai Strategic Sewerage Tunnel project, which entails 75 kilometers of two deep wastewater tunnels, deep pump stations, and 220 kilometers of link sewers. This converts Dubai from a lift station system to a full gravity system. Our scope included updates to the master plan flow forecasts, feasibility studies, preliminary design, and tender preparation. Read more.

Delaware Aqueduct Bypass tunnel project
We delivered the largest repair project ever in New York City’s water supply system for the state’s Delaware Aqueduct Bypass. This ensured that the longest tunnel in the world could continue to deliver water to 9 million New Yorkers.
